The major fight that fans want to see most this year is the fifth showdown between Juan Manuel Marquez and Manny Pacquiao, according to a recent poll conducted on the RingTV.com homepage.
The poll question that asked "What fight would you most like to see
made in 2013?" was answered with more than 20,000 votes that were
distributed among seven possible significant matchups. Marquez-Pacquiao V
received the highest percentage of votes with 29.9%, followed by a
showdown between middleweight champ Sergio Martinez and pound-for-pound
king Floyd Mayweather, which garnered 23.4%.
A Mayweather-Saul "Canelo" Alvarez fight was a close third with 22.6%. A
fight between junior featherweight titleholders -- Nonito Donaire and
Abner Mares -- attracted 13.7 percent of the vote. The other choices
each attracted less than 4%.
Marquez finally beat his arch rival Pacquiao with a shocking
sixth-round KO in their fourth fight last December. Fans of the Filipino
icon, who held a 2-0-1 edge over the Mexican veteran in their first
three razor-thin distance bouts, obviously want to see if their hero can
get revenge in a fifth bout.
